Phnom Penh, Cambodia — Cambodia is on track to significantly boost its solar energy share, with new figures projecting solar to make up 7% of the country’s electricity supply by 2025. This equates to a total installed capacity of 530.14 megawatts (MW) —a major leap from 3.2% in 2023 and 4.6% in 2024. [pdf]

Energy in North Korea describes energy and electricity production, consumption and import in North Korea. North Korea is a net energy exporter. Primary energy use in North Korea was 224 TWh and 9 TWh per million people in 2009. The country's primary sources of power are hydro and coal after Kim Jong Il. .
